What is NFPA 13 and Why Does It Matter?



NFPA 13 is the foundational requirement for the layout and installment of automated fire lawn sprinkler in the United States. It has actually been shaping fire security practices for over a century, and every update mirrors the latest research, screening, and field experience. The basic covers whatever from system design and design criteria to installation practices and examination protocols.



With new risks arising in both residential and industrial settings, the 2025 alteration intends to maintain systems effective and compliant with contemporary structure designs and usages.

Updated Design Criteria to Reflect Modern Building Materials



In recent times, changes in building construction and components have dramatically influenced fire characteristics. The NFPA 13 2025 version takes these variables right into account with changed design standards that extra properly mirror real-world fire dangers.



New tables, updated lawn sprinkler spacing rules, and modified layout area demands currently much better straighten with today's building patterns. This makes certain systems are neither over- neither under-designed and that they react appropriately to the particular fire hazards within a given framework.



As an example, facilities with high-piled storage space or lightweight building products may now need to satisfy modified thickness and discharge needs. These refinements aid customize fire security systems to the actual conditions they're most likely to face.

Improved Clarity on Water Supply and System Hydraulics



Supply of water stays the lifeline of any kind of fire automatic sprinkler. The NFPA 13 2025 version fine-tunes the requirements used to evaluate water need, pressure loss, and hydraulic performance. By eliminating unclear terms and changing them with more precise interpretations and estimations, the new version minimizes the risk of mistakes in system style.



These modifications are especially pertinent to residential or commercial properties located in areas with variable water stress or older infrastructure. Guaranteeing your automatic sprinkler gets sufficient and constant water circulation is important for both code conformity and life safety.
